No trucking Company's left to work for??

Is there any trucking company's left to work for that you have not listed here? they can't all be bad I wonder what they would say about you all. There's two sides to every story. So guys and gal's give them a break. Please take a time to cool down before you post they may not be as bad as you thank.
In my forty years trucking I quite a lot of Good jobs because I just got pissed off and was taird. The next day I was sorry I did. So thank twice. Danny a retired trucker
PS I worked for several of these folks and found them to fair and honest people to work for.

i agree, but, alot of these companies are only "sausage makers". they process you and spit you out. they either offer crappy equipment, and or low miles ,lack of interest in treating you like an adult or human, because to them all that matters is the bottom line of making money to fill their pockets and not yours/ours.
i understand that they are here for the money, but what they ask you to do is not totally ethical or legal or humane. such as barring you from idleing to keep cool or warm and to get the proper rest to run and make money.
call me cynical, but that is exactly what i am.........
best wishes to all the sausages out here,keep up the good work letting everyone know what despots these companies are.

Well said, zedanny. Yet many will counter your post. Just like mcr6468 ho says he agrees ad then makes the exact comments you addressed. Mcr6468, if trucking is so horrible then why are you still doing it? I doubt anyone is holding a gun to your head telling you to drive a truck. Go find some other work. The reality is EVERY company, trucking and non-trucking, is looking out for their bottom line. They did not go in business to give you a job, they went into business to make a profit. And when you look at how narrow the profit margin is for most trucking companies (less than 10%) it is obvious they are not getting rich at it. If you want to bea trucker and ALL the companies are "sausage grinders" then why not buy your own truck, get your own authority and run your own trucking company the way a trucking company should be run. Then if you get treated like sausage, you will have no one to blame but yourself.

I think people get into trucking thinking that they are going to have a life like smokey and the bandit or B.J and the bear or any of the other trucking movies. This drives thier expectations way to high. Fact is, trucking company's are no different than any other company. My mother in law works for Pepsi. She always has someone watching her waiting to pounce if she makes a wrong move. I think I would go postal in there if it were me. My stepson works in a mine where everyone wants to be a chief and you can be run off if a supervisor happens to not like you.

A job is where people go to "work". Most of the time "work" is not fun. We work to earn money to pay our bills. When we are home we are free to have fun, relax, enjoy our life. Complaining about how bad our work sucks is just making "work" worse on ourselves and stresses out anyone listening. So. Go to work, earn money. Go home, enjoy life.......Peace
